Aims

To compare crop safety of Sakura on two barley varieties (Hindmarsh and Scope) sown at different depths.

Key messages

The relatively new herbicide Sakura is currently registered for use in wheat only; in barley this product caused a yield penalty. Effects may not be seen in early stages of plant growth, as Sakura affects the root system. Deep sowing did not have an interaction with Sakura application.
